Thanks, they are mainly synths that I have either designed from scratch or taken the core of another synth and expanded it. The wooden housed device is a midi controller for the Arturia CS80v virtual synth, it reads in approx 128 sliders and switches and outputs them as MIDI messages for the synth and it also has a seperate ribbon controller strip to emulate the ribbon on the original CS80

That's my little beauty, still looks the same. The headlights were a one off with the Q7 V12 daytime running lights cut down by 3 leds and then fitted into a set of split headlights from a 2001 car. Controller was supplied by Kufatec to control dimming when indicating, low beam etc, coming home functions. A very expensive conversion that probably cost me around £1000 at the time with over half of that being the Q7 lights.
